Tips for Picking Music in Advertising
Picking tunes for commercials needs insight into your customers, brand identity, and the campaign’s message. The music should:
- Reflect the tone – happy, relaxed, intense, or fun, depending on the ad’s style.
- Align with brand personality – classic, contemporary, cutting-edge, or reliable.
- Suit the cultural context – fitting the preferences of your viewers.
- Enhance storytelling – not distracting from the visuals.
Pros and Cons of Music Options
Music for ads can be either bespoke or licensed. Original music offers exclusivity and uniqueness, but can be require more resources. Licensed music offers variety and familiarity but comes with legal considerations.

Common Music Styles in Ads
Different music genres convey distinct feelings and messages. Commonly used genres include:
- Popular music – upbeat and relatable.
- Classical – cultured and graceful.
- Soulful tunes – smooth and cool.
- Synth-based – tech-savvy and vibrant.
- Folk – natural and honest.

Finding Music for Advertising
Sourcing music can be done through various methods:
- Stock music libraries – websites offering pre-made tracks.
- Original soundtrack production – working with music agencies for tailored pieces.
- Collaborations with artists – supporting independent artists.
Avoiding Copyright Issues
Understanding licensing is crucial to prevent infringement. This includes synchronisation rights, public performance rights, and mechanical rights, depending on where and how the ad is shown.
